On 23 October 2025, COPECARE's four professors presented Grand Rounds demonstrating how diagnostic and therapeutic approaches to inflammatory arthritis have evolved at remarkable speed over recent decades.
With the introduction of targeted biologics, earlier and more precise diagnostic tools, treat-to-target strategies, and non-pharmacological treatments, clinical outcomes have shifted fundamentally. Patients now achieve disease control and quality-of-life levels that were rarely possible 30 years ago, when therapeutic options were limited and often insufficient.
For clinicians, researchers, and translational scientists, these developments underscore a rapidly advancing field.
